M. D. Johnson Coyote Calls

tip34_400 

Traditional “wounded rabbit” squeals and squalls can work fine for coyotes; however, pressured dogs may respond better to off-beat sounds such as woodpecker screams, housecat howls, or even low-key mouse squeaks. Don’t be shy about giving them something different, and remember loud isn’t necessarily better.
